The symbolic language of herbal archetypes

Each plant holds a unique symbolic meaning. Besides nurturing and healing, they also contain a type of energy and a lesson to teach. Some of these energies can be linked to tarot cards and their archetypes.

A fascinating example to illustrate the point is hemlock. It is a tall and upright plant with toxic properties. Its form and biological effects show rigidity and protection, just like The Emperor card.

Hemlock protects itself against predators with poisonous chemicals. It has an upright form that does not yield. These features help the plant survive in the wild, but taken to an extreme they won’t let us relate to its virtues. 

Similarly, authoritative and close-minded people may seem challenging to approach. But they are probably highly protective towards their loved ones.

Alfalfa is a completely different plant. It easily thrives in diverse environments. However, it is also adaptable and friendly for animals who want to feed from it and spread its seeds in return.

Alfalfa exemplifies resilience and inner strength in trying times. This aligns to the feeling behind the Ten of Swords, and how it comes across suffering. But after such difficult times when nothing can be worse, the future will shine brighter if we keep at it.

1) Butterbur

This might sound like a delicious beverage but it is actually a herb that grows throughout Europe. It has also been used for centuries to treat migraine headaches. In fact, even scientists have recommended using this herb to reduce the severity and frequency of migraines. If you do choose to use Butterbur, make sure you get a high-quality supplement that does not have some of the harmful chemicals present in the raw plant.

2) Ginger

Ginger has been a staple of traditional medicine for thousands of years. Its anti-inflammatory properties are quite popular and it is the go-to natural remedy for a lot of people in eastern countries. Its healing properties also make it the perfect choice for treating migraine headaches. What’s great about ginger is that it can be consumed in a variety of ways. You could make tea out of it, consume it in powder form, or even take ginger supplements.

3) Feverfew

Feverfew is a flowering herb that looks like a daisy. It has been used for centuries to treat migraine headaches, stomach aches, insect bites, and even fertility problems. It is said that feverfew reduces inflammation in the body and prevents the constriction of blood vessels in the brain. This is what provides relief from migraine headaches. However, scientists are still studying its effects and are yet to come to a conclusion on its effectiveness.
